[net-next] drivers:net: Convert dma_alloc_coherent(...__GFP_ZERO) to dma_zalloc_coherent

Message ID 1377582323.2658.10.camel@joe-AO722
State Accepted, archived
Delegated to: David Miller
Headers show

Commit Message

Joe Perches Aug. 27, 2013, 5:45 a.m. UTC
__GFP_ZERO is an uncommon flag and perhaps is better
not used.  static inline dma_zalloc_coherent exists
so convert the uses of dma_alloc_coherent with __GFP_ZERO
to the more common kernel style with zalloc.

Remove memset from the static inline dma_zalloc_coherent
and add just one use of __GFP_ZERO instead.

Trivially reduces the size of the existing uses of
dma_zalloc_coherent.

Realign arguments as appropriate.

diff --git a/include/linux/dma-mapping.h b/include/linux/dma-mapping.h
index 94af418..3a8d0a2 100644
--- a/include/linux/dma-mapping.h
+++ b/include/linux/dma-mapping.h
@@ -132,9 +132,8 @@  static inline int dma_set_seg_boundary(struct device *dev, unsigned long mask)
 static inline void *dma_zalloc_coherent(struct device *dev, size_t size,
 					dma_addr_t *dma_handle, gfp_t flag)
 {
-	void *ret = dma_alloc_coherent(dev, size, dma_handle, flag);
-	if (ret)
-		memset(ret, 0, size);
+	void *ret = dma_alloc_coherent(dev, size, dma_handle,
+				       flag | __GFP_ZERO);
 	return ret;
 }
